#2d612d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2d612d is composed of 17.6% red, 38% green and 17.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 53.6% yellow and 62% black. It has a hue angle of 120 degrees, a saturation of 36.6% and a lightness of 27.8%. #2d612d color hex could be obtained by blending #5ac25a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

● #2d612d color description : Very dark desaturated lime green.
#2d612d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2d612d has RGB values of R:45, G:97, B:45 and CMYK values of C:0.54, M:0, Y:0.54,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 2973997.
